I'm calling this giveaway "Sisterhood of the Traveling Book"... so here we have a book called "Making room for making art" "A thoughtful and practical guide to bringing the pleasure of artistic expression back into your life." By Sally Warner. It has pictures (black and white) and is an easy read. It has 208 pages not including the appendixes and notes.

Here's what Sally has written on the back:
"I hope that this book will help break through some of the isolation every artist faces by exploring how we as artists discover our art, how we continue to discover it, and how we keep making that art, in spite of everything. Artist momentum can be regained and vision sustained."
